Portable Generator
DynamicGenerator.png
Recipe
Created With Electronics Printer
Cost 15g Gold, 20g Steel, 15g Nickel, 5g Solder


Description[edit]

A portable machine used to charge Battery Cells using fuel. It can be attached to a Power Connector to supply power to a grid.

Use[edit]

Insert a canister of fuel into the slot on the left side. Insert battery in the slot above the power switch and hit the switch.

Recipes[edit]

Since it consumes pressure, you can increase the output by supercooling it. Also the fuel mix ratio matters as unburned fuel isn't converted into energy.

Fuel mix ratio Temperature Power output
100% Fuel 250 °C 359.726 W
100% Fuel 50°C 582.422 W
100% Fuel 20°C 642.026 W
100% Fuel 0° C 689.035 W
100% Fuel -75°C 949.835 W
100% Fuel -150°C 1528.297 W
100% Superfuel 40°C 901.532 W
100% Superfuel 20°C 963.038 W
100% Superfuel 0°C 1033.552 W
100% Superfuel -20°C 1115.207 W
